Q: Is 17,170,610 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 17,170,610 is a composite number.

Why is 17,170,610 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 17,170,610 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 29 58 145 290 59,209 118,418 296,045 592,090 1,717,061 3,434,122 8,585,305 and 17,170,610, with no remainder.

Since 17,170,610 cannot be divided by just 1 and 17,170,610, it is a composite number.
